Michael Ellsberg is the author of The Education of Millionaires and The Last Safe Investment. As a writer, Michael is in a field that is quickly being subsumed by Artificial Intelligence and Michael has devoted a lot of his time thinking and writing about the implications of AI in the career and education landscapes.
In this episode, we dive into some of the pressing questions around the future of AI; What jobs is AI going to take away? What skills should we be learning to remain competitive? Should AI be a part of the classroom? We discuss Michael’s opinions on college, his thoughts on critical thinking and his critiques on higher education’s lag in adopting technology and trends. Michael also shares his favorite generative AI tools and gives practical advice on how we can use AI to enhance our productivity and sharpen our thinking
